Antique 18ct yellow gold, emerald, ruby and diamond posie claddagh ring

A central old mine cut diamond is set to the centre of alternating oval old mine cut natural ruby and emerald ‘petals’ forming a posie design.

Two finely chased gold hands form the shoulders of the ring.

Diamond has long been a symbol of everlasting love, ruby for passion and emerald truthful love.

To the reverse of the ring is a rock crystal covered locket.

English Circa 1840.
